Frequently Asked Questions

Can you help prioritize repairs after hail or wind events?

Yes. Impact patterns, corner damage, and accessory metal deformation are commonly triaged for urgent versus deferred work. Local note: Coordinate anchor — 44.8800, -94.0400.

Do you help with panel matching for partial repairs?

Often, yes. Repair scopes commonly include matching profiles and aligning corners, trim, and existing elevations when possible.

Will timeline expectations be shared before dispatch?

Can you help compare siding material options?

Yes. Vinyl, fiber cement, engineered wood, and composite options can be reviewed based on durability and maintenance goals.
